Why prism_company is rated Low

This is a classic Read operation: it retrieves and enriches data about companies and domains without modifying anything. While the server operates on a pay-per-call model (incurring $0.005–$0.05 USDC per call), the tool itself does not move money or commit financial obligations — the payment is infrastructure cost handled by the platform, not a financial operation executed by the tool.

From the tool's definition Tool performs 'firmographic enrichment for any domain: legal entity, DNS/WHOIS, TLS and web footprint' — these are all data retrieval and lookup operations with no modification, deletion, execution, or financial transaction capability.

Can I rate-limit prism_company? +

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the prism_company r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.

How do I block prism_company completely? +

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for prism_company.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
